Output 8f62f544fa72b3c6e62de44a1dbf8315e8f259fbee9ad73a96bef90db4d7d98a:255

value
101205
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cccc75a1cd3e8463529af38539701ed393aa0a6fc8f555fb9f8bcaee643e2208
address
tb1penx8tgwd86zxx5567wznjuq76wf65zn0er64t7ul309wuep7ygyqjsg0e4
transaction
8f62f544fa72b3c6e62de44a1dbf8315e8f259fbee9ad73a96bef90db4d7d98a
confirmations
302
spent
false

1 Sat Range